Abstract

Un sensor de gas electroquímico que presenta un elemento sensible a la temperatura tal como un termistor dispuesto dentro del sensor de gas en unaforma aislante de temperatura para evitar cualquier variación en la temperatura de los gasesaplica dos a ser sensados y a ser direccionados inmediatamente alelemento sensible a la temperatura proporcionando por lo tanto senales de compensación de temperatura ajustadas para ser combinadas con las senales desalida eléctricas generadaspor el s ensor. El elemento sensible de temperatura o termistor está montado en un sumidero de calor a una membrana de expansióndel sensor de gas que responde unicamente a los cambios en las variaciones de temperatura impartidas por elelectrolito de senso r y no por las variaciones dela temperatura del cuerpo del sensor de gas y elementos asociados por lo cual proporciona senales de compensación de temperatura correctas sin demoras detiempo que producen errores.
